Job summary

MaineHealth is seeking a Sterile Supply Technician I at Maine Medical Center to decontaminate, clean, process, and sterilize supplies and equipment used throughout the hospital.

Eligible applicants may receive a $2000 sign-on bonus. A High School diploma or GED is preferred, with CRCST certification preferred or required within 24 months depending on location, and at least 1 year of related experience.

Notice Regarding Maine Employer Surveillance Statute

Pursuant to Maine's Employer Surveillance Statute, prospective care team members are notified that MaineHealth may monitor, collect, record, review, or retain information related to the use of its systems, networks, applications, files, data, communications platforms (including notified recordings), smart badges, building access, company vehicle GPS data, business calls, and workplace security cameras. Information collected may be used for legitimate business purposes, including security, safety, compliance, investigations, training, quality assurance, and operational management.
